Output d59ec561ba5a048f9ef5b3511fd15354f43504cc4f4fd7f8980f291eeb8120d6:2

value
357268254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ffd6d58e6f620e13fcc18a905206aa1913e2c13 OP_EQUALVERIFY OP_CHECKSIG
address
1CfkQnkAYTYFpnLkvospkYTxcMfDdqkTFF
transaction
d59ec561ba5a048f9ef5b3511fd15354f43504cc4f4fd7f8980f291eeb8120d6
spent
true